Rumors starting to fly around, however this one has some reasoning and legs behind it. Apparently, it's true that FSU has negotiated some sort of buyout from the ACC, and we all know that Oregon and Washington would jump to the Big Ten in a heartbeat after USC, UCLA, and Colorado all left.

Clemson part of this makes me skeptical, for some reason I buy FSU to the Big Ten way more than Clemson.

In the end, I think it's a bit of a stretch... however at this point who the heck knows? From a football standpoint it certainly makes sense, and some more southern schools in the mix could be good for the other sports like baseball and track & field to go with USC & UCLA.

If it was me, and I had to choose 4 teams... Washington and Oregon are no brainers because it's less of an island for USC and UCLA, though at that point do you bring in 2 more western teams for a more geographical balance or just get the best programs you can?

If taking more west teams after Washington/Oregon, the list probably looks like:

  1. Stanford/Cal (I believe they'd be a package deal like USC/UCLA)
  2. Arizona / Arizona State (Package)
  3. Utah (Only if they can find a strong 2nd team to bring in with them though... like ND)

That's it, I don't think the Big would remotely consider anyone else. Now, if looking east at those final 2 after Oregon/Washington the list could be much longer.
